//废话不多说,复制就完了
$origin = isset($_SERVER['HTTP_ORIGIN'])? $_SERVER['HTTP_ORIGIN'] : '';
$allowOrigin = array(
'https://www.baidu.com/',
'https://www.google.com/'
);
if (in_array($origin, $allowOrigin)) {
header("Access-Control-Allow-Origin:".$origin);
}
PHP 跨域 Access-Control-Allow-Origin设置多个域名
最后编辑于 :
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。
推荐阅读更多精彩内容
- 【跨域】解决办法:利用 Access-Control-Allow-Origin 传统的跨域请求没有好的解决方案,无...
- ajax跨域访问是一个老问题了,解决方法很多,比较常用的是JSONP方法,JSONP方法是一种非官方方法,而且这种...
- CORS跨域设置 CORS(Cross-originresourcesharing),跨域资源共享,是一份浏览器技...
- 什么是跨域 当两个域具有相同的协议(如http), 相同的端口(如80),相同的host(如www.google....
- 通过设置Access-Control-Allow-Origin来实现跨域。 例如:客户端的域名是client.xx...